Lakewood Ranch is the master-planned community spanning Sarasota and Manatee Counties — consistently ranked among America's top-selling master-planned communities for multiple consecutive years and emerging as one of the most significant CRE growth stories in the Southeast. Anchored by University Town Center (UTC) mall, Lakewood Ranch Main Street town center, and Lakewood Ranch Medical Center. Lakewood Ranch commercial real estate sellers benefit from one of the Florida Gulf Coast's most active institutional buyer pools — driven by 1031 exchangers with identified-property deadlines, family-office mandates, and institutional REIT capital allocations. Who buys Lakewood Ranch commercial property?

Lakewood Ranch buyer activity comes from institutional REITs and private equity (for stabilized institutional-quality assets), family offices with Florida CRE mandates, 1031 exchangers with identified-property deadlines, and value-add operators targeting reposition opportunities. Specific buyer matching depends on your asset profile.
